Red Team Operations
Full adversary simulation: black-box, social engineering, physical and wireless, against a live defence.
A penetration test asks whether a system can be broken. A red team engagement asks whether your people, process and detection notice. Objective-led, black-box, run against production with the SOC unaware — phishing and pretexting, wireless and physical entry, lateral movement and exfiltration — measured against MITRE ATT&CK so the outcome is a detection gap map rather than a war story.

Post-Quantum (PQC) Readiness
Cryptographic inventory, Harvest Now Decrypt Later exposure and a migration plan with dates on it.
Encrypted traffic captured today can be stored until a quantum computer can open it — the Harvest Now, Decrypt Later problem. Long-lived secrets are already exposed. I inventory what cryptography you actually use, score which of it fails under HNDL, and set out a migration path to NIST post-quantum standards in the order that reduces real risk first. Incident Response and CSIRT Readiness
Containment when it is happening, and the playbooks that stop the next one becoming a crisis.
Live incident command through triage, containment, eradication and recovery — plus the preparation that decides how the bad day goes. Playbooks, tabletop exercises and a tested escalation path, written on the principle that governs emergency medicine and applies exactly to incident response: do no harm. Most of the damage in an incident is done by the response, not the intruder.
